Why Grocery Store Boxes Are a Risk
While free boxes from a local market seem like a budget-friendly choice, they carry hidden dangers. Used food containers frequently harbor bacteria or pests like German cockroaches, which thrive in the South Florida warmth. These boxes have already been weakened by previous shipping cycles and refrigerated storage environments. Inconsistent sizing makes it impossible to create a stable load in the moving van. A single collapsed box at the bottom of a stack can cause an entire wall of belongings to tip during a turn, leading to avoidable damage.
The Role of Corrugated Fiberboard
The quality of your materials is determined by the corrugated fiberboard construction. Look for the circular manufacturer’s stamp on the bottom of the box to find the ECT rating. The Edge Crush Test (ECT) rating is the industry standard for box strength in 2026, measuring how much pressure a box wall can withstand before buckling. For heavy kitchen appliances or large book collections, double-walled boxes are necessary. These provide two layers of fluting that increase stacking strength by over 50 percent compared to standard single-wall containers. This extra reinforcement is vital for long-distance moves where items remain stacked for several days.
Essential Types of Packing Supplies for Fort Lauderdale Relocations
Choosing the right moving boxes Fort Lauderdale residents trust is the first step toward a damage-free relocation. Professional movers utilize four standard sizes to manage weight and stackability effectively. Small boxes, typically 1.5 cubic feet, are the workhorses for heavy items like books, tools, or canned goods. Medium boxes offer 3.0 cubic feet of space for general household items like toys and small appliances. Large and extra-large boxes, ranging from 4.5 to 6.0 cubic feet, should stay reserved for light, voluminous items like pillows and linens. Using these specific sizes prevents boxes from becoming too heavy to lift safely, which reduces the risk of bottom-out failures during transit.
Specialty Boxes You Shouldn’t Skip
Generic containers often fail to protect high-value or awkwardly shaped items. Wardrobe boxes are the biggest time-saver for Las Olas closets. They feature a metal hanging bar that allows you to move clothes directly from the rack to the box without folding or re-hanging. For your kitchen, dish barrels are essential. These boxes use double-walled corrugated cardboard, providing the 200-pound burst strength needed for South Florida’s fine china and glassware. Mirror and picture boxes utilize a telescoping design to provide a custom fit for expensive artwork. This rigid structure absorbs the constant vibrations of I-95 travel, keeping glass and frames intact throughout the journey.
Beyond the Box: Protective Materials
Proper packing requires specialized buffers that go beyond simple cardboard. Plain packing paper is always better than old newsprint. Newsprint often leaves permanent ink stains on porcelain and glass, requiring hours of unnecessary cleaning later. When wrapping delicate items, moving-grade bubble wrap with 3/16-inch bubbles provides superior surface protection compared to thin retail alternatives. For those looking for professional packing tips, the use of industrial stretch wrap is a top recommendation. This plastic film protects furniture from humidity and dust during storage. It’s also effective for securing cabinet doors and drawers without using adhesive tape that might damage delicate wood finishes.

How to Calculate the Right Amount of Moving Boxes and Supplies
Accurately estimating your inventory is the first step toward a stress-free relocation. Professional movers use a base formula of 15 boxes for every 100 square feet of living space to establish a baseline. You’ll need to adjust this figure based on your specific lifestyle and storage habits. A minimalist condo in downtown Fort Lauderdale typically uses 20% fewer supplies than a high-density family home in Weston. Suburban homes often feature garages and attic spaces that require a higher volume of heavy-duty moving boxes Fort Lauderdale suppliers provide for long-term durability.
Always secure 10% more materials than your initial estimate. This professional standard prevents late-night trips to the hardware store when you’re in the middle of a room. It’s much better to have five extra moving boxes Fort Lauderdale than to run out while packing fragile items. Having a surplus allows you to double-box heavy electronics or fragile heirlooms without worrying about depleting your stock. Proper preparation ensures you aren’t forced to use flimsy, makeshift containers that compromise the safety of your belongings.
Estimation Guide by Home Size
Home size is the most reliable predictor of your supply needs. A 1-bedroom apartment typically requires 30 to 45 boxes, including a mix of small and medium sizes. A 3-bedroom family home sees a sharp jump to 80 or 100 boxes, which must include 10 dish barrels and 6 wardrobe boxes for closets. Estates with 5 or more bedrooms often exceed 200 boxes, making professional packing services a necessity for homes over 4,500 square feet to maintain organization.
The Packing Supply Checklist
Quantifying smaller supplies prevents mid-move delays. Buy one roll of tape for every 15 to 20 boxes to ensure you don’t run out. For the average kitchen, 15 lbs of packing paper is standard, though large china collections require 25 lbs. Always use heavy-duty tape dispensers and thick permanent markers to label every side of your containers. This ensures movers know exactly where to place items in your new home, reducing unloading time by up to 30%.

What kind of tape is best for the Florida humidity?
Acrylic-based packing tape is the superior choice for the Florida climate because it maintains its bond in temperatures reaching 120 degrees Fahrenheit. Standard hot-melt adhesives often fail when local humidity levels exceed 65%, which can cause your boxes to pop open unexpectedly. Always look for tape that’s 2.5 to 3 mils thick to ensure the moving boxes Fort Lauderdale heat won’t compromise your item security.
